问题遇到的现象和发生背景
comsol流固耦合怎么在封闭腔里让固体旋转带动流体旋转
操作环境、软件版本等信息
comsol
尝试过的解决方法
尝试过在固体力学物理场中加入了旋转坐标系,还是旋转不了

我想要达到的结果
分析固体旋转带动流体旋转时,流体受到的压力和流速
你想在comsol中实现流固耦合,让旋转的固体带动流体旋转,但是目前尝试的方法无法实现。我有以下几点建议:
- 检查旋转边界条件设置是否正确。在comsol中实现旋转,需要在Geometry中定义旋转轴和旋转速度,然后在相应的物理场中应用旋转坐标系和旋转速度边界条件。需要确保坐标系选择正确,速度大小和方向也正确。
- 检查流固界面的设置是否正确。实现流固耦合需要在流体域和固体域之间建立流固界面,选择“流固耦合”作为界面类型,并选择对应的速度和力的映射关系。界面设置不正确会导致无法实现流固耦合。
- 确保模型的网格足够精细。实现流固耦合和旋转运动都需要较精细的网格,否则会导致计算不精确和耦合不完全。可以适当增细网格尺寸和增加网格层数。
- 检查Solver设置是否正确。流固耦合问题需要multiphysics solver,同时需要激活“旋转”模块以及选择与物理场相匹配的元素类型。这些设置不正确会导致无法求解。
- 如果以上设置都正确但仍不行,可能是模型本身的某些方面设计不合理。需要重新检查模型的构建是否符合流固耦合和旋转运动的物理要求。
希望以上提示能对您有所帮助。